GLOBALES

Description: The ‘GLOBALES’ refer to variables or configurations that apply throughout the system, meaning their scope is not limited to a single program or process but affects multiple components and applications within a computing environment. These global configurations are essential for maintaining consistency and uniformity in the operation of a system, as they allow for the establishment of parameters that are recognized and used by different parts of the software. For example, in various programming environments and operating systems, global environment variables can define settings such as the system language, the location of temporary files, or library search paths. The importance of ‘GLOBALES’ lies in their ability to simplify configuration management, facilitating system administration and ensuring that all programs operate under the same conditions. Additionally, their use can contribute to security and efficiency, as it allows administrators to set policies and restrictions that apply uniformly across the system. In summary, ‘GLOBALES’ are a fundamental tool in system configuration, providing a common framework that enhances interoperability and resource management.
